#43b0e2 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#43b0e2 is composed of 26.3% red, 69% green and 88.6%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 70.4% cyan, 22.1% magenta, 0% yellow and 11.4% black. It has a hue angle of 198.9 degrees, a saturation of 73.3% and a lightness of 57.5%. #43b0e2 color hex could be obtained by blending #86ffff with #0061c5. Closest websafe color is: #3399cc.

Shades and Tints of #43b0e2
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#020c10 is the darkest color, while #feffff is the lightest one.
